‘Shaking was so strong’: 5 killed as major quake strikes Philippines

A 7.4-magnitude earthquake on Friday morning off the southern Philippines killed at least five people, set off landslides, damaged hospitals and schools and prompted evacuations of coastal areas nearby because of a tsunami warning, which was later lifted.
